In each part, nd the general solution of the given di erential equation. A. dy dx x2 + 2y2 xy u = y/x. We can rewrite the equation as dy dx x y. Let u = y/x (where y is a solution of our equation), then y = xu, so y = u + xu . We substitute this expression for the left-hand side of the equation, and rewrite the equation as u + x du dx. Subtracting u from both sides of the equation, we get x du dx. Putting the right-hand side over a common denominator gives x du dx u2 + 1 u. Separating the variables in this equation, we get u. 1 + u2 du = z dx x. The integral on the left can be done by the simple substitution v = 1 + u2. 2 ln|1 + u2| = ln|x| + c.
